you have several options.
- you can lurk them from the known rest zone into the mission area by using the caller and just slowly walk (they follow you).
- walk from a longer distance to the mission area (more than 600m ) - because in the last patch they prevented that animals spawn in front of you - so I guess that your spawn-in (a tent for example) has a animal-free zone around it.
- if there are really no coyotes in the area ( I had this problem at Vualez #7 ) - then just delete the file "animal_population" from you savegame (disable steam-cloud sync before)
The file is located at ...\Documents\Avalanche Studios\theHunter Call of the Wild\Saves\#### (a big number)
The game creates a new one - which will be up2date to the last terrain changes. It helped for me.
